Remote Otter LogoRemoteOtter

Java Backend Developer - Remote

Posted 16 hours ago
Software Development
Full Time
Worldwide

Overview

As a Backend Developer at Viber, you will be involved in developing and maintaining high-traffic applications with over 1 billion messages a day, ensuring the fast and reliable operation of our platform.

In Short

  • Planning, designing, developing and maintaining Java high-availability applications.
  • Define application objectives and functionality.
  • Ensure application designs conform with business goals.
  • Support continuous improvement and present for architectural review.
  • Work closely with Product and Architects teams on mission-critical systems.

Requirements

  • At least 7 years of experience as a Backend Developer, with 3 years in Java.
  • Advanced knowledge of Java and experience in Async/reactive Java frameworks.
  • Advanced knowledge of unit testing frameworks and mocking.
  • Knowledge of cloud technologies.
  • Experience with large scale NoSQL databases.
  • Experience with microservices development based on Docker and Kubernetes.
  • Experience with Agile methodology.
  • Fluent in written and spoken English.
  • Excellent communication skills.
  • Higher technical education.

Benefits

  • Knowledge of C++ is an advantage.
  • Experience with other server-side languages such as Node.js, Go, Python is a plus.
  • Experience working with remote teams.
Viber logo

Viber

Rakuten Viber is a leading global communication platform that aims to enhance the lives of its users by facilitating meaningful connections. With a mission to create a super-app, Viber is dedicated to providing safe and convenient communication tools for hundreds of millions of users worldwide. The company fosters a culture of innovation, teamwork, and excellence, and is committed to developing scalable and high-performing backend systems. Viber's team of engineers is focused on transitioning to modern architectures and delivering high-quality solutions in a collaborative environment.

Share This Job!

Save This Job!

Similar Jobs:

Rubikal logo

Backend Developer (Java) - Remote

Rubikal

5 weeks ago

We are looking for a skilled Backend Developer specializing in Java to design and maintain scalable enterprise applications.

Egypt
Full-time
Software Development
Uni Systems logo

Java Backend Developer - Remote

Uni Systems

6 weeks ago

Join Uni Systems as a Java Backend Developer and contribute to the development of innovative software solutions.

Belgium
Full-time
Software Development
Neoshare logo

Java Backend Developer - Remote

Neoshare

7 weeks ago

Join a fast-growing Fintech/Proptech as a Java Backend Developer, contributing to innovative products in a flexible and collaborative environment.

Germany
Full-time
Software Development
Qode logo

Java Backend Developer - Remote

Qode

10 weeks ago

We are seeking an experienced Java Backend Developer to lead backend development initiatives and drive scalable solutions.

PA, USA
Full-time
Software Development
inbybob_ logo

Java Backend Developer - Remote

inbybob_

10 weeks ago

Join our client as a Java Backend Developer to create microservices and software solutions using the Spring Framework.

Bulgaria
Full-time
Software Development